CARY, N.C. — The Matt Cossa Memorial Foundation is holding its seventh annual Bats for Matt fundraiser on Saturday, April 20. Tickets are $5, and the proceeds will benefit Make-A-Wish Eastern North Carolina.
This fun family event takes place at Green Hope High School during their baseball team's match against Broughton. In addition to baseball, there will be live music, including performances by the UNC Loreleis, a magician, a silent auction, inflatables and more. Tickets are $5 for adults, and children 10 and under get in free.

Raffle tickets are $5 each, or $20 for five. The prizes are an iPad, a $150 Visa gift card and an iPod shuffle. There are many silent auction prizes, including a WRAL studio tour with Debra Morgan, rounds of golf at various area golf clubs, a weekend at the Washington Duke Inn and a Bald Head Island getaway,.

This event should be a lot of fun and benefits a good cause. The Matt Cossa Memorial Foundation was founded after Matt Cossa, a 2003 graduate of Green Hope, passed away from Hodgkin's Lymphona during his junior year at UNC-Chapel Hill. The foundation formed in his honor supports cancer patients, research and treatment.
Bats for Matt will benefit Make-A-Wish Eastern North Carolina, an organization which grants the wishes of children with life-threatening medical conditions.
